#bc554d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c554d is composed of 73.7% red, 33.3%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.8% magenta, 59%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 4.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 52%. #bc554d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a9a with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#bc554d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bc554d has RGB values of R:188, G:85,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.59,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12342605.

Shades and Tints of #bc554d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070303 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c554d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d7d7c is the less saturated color, while #fe1d0b is the most saturated one.
